King Brandel Character Analysis

King Brandel is a secondary character in the anime "Didn't I Say to Make My Abilities Average in the Next Life?!". He is the ruler of the Kingdom of Brandel and is known for his arrogance and overconfidence. Despite being a powerful king, he is also depicted as being cruel and selfish towards his people. Brandel's appearance in the anime is quite distinct. He has a tall stature with broad shoulders, and he wears a white robe with gold trimmings. His hair is neatly combed and reaches down to his shoulders. He also wears a small golden crown that symbolizes his royal status. Brandel is introduced in the anime as a potential threat to the protagonist, Mile, and her friend Pauline. In Episode 4, the two girls get into a conflict with an army soldier who works for King Brandel. As a result, they are summoned to the king's palace, where they meet him for the first time. Brandel immediately expresses his dislike for Mile and her friends and decides to punish them for their misdeeds. Throughout the rest of the anime, Brandel continues to play a significant role as an antagonist. He often schemes against Mile and her friends, and his presence adds tension to the overall story. Despite his cruel nature, he is also seen as a charismatic leader who commands respect from his people. Overall, King Brandel is an interesting character who adds depth and complexity to the anime's storyline.

Which Enneagram Type is King Brandel?

King Brandel from "Didn't I Say to Make My Abilities Average in the Next Life?!" appears to be an Enneagram Type 8, the Challenger. He is assertive, decisive, and confident in his actions and beliefs. He is also highly protective of his kingdom and the people within it, showing a strong sense of loyalty and responsibility. On the downside, his assertiveness can sometimes come across as domineering and controlling, and he can struggle with vulnerability and letting others take charge. He may also have a tendency to view the world in black and white terms and can become confrontational when challenged. Overall, King Brandel's Type 8 tendencies drive his strong leadership and protective nature, but can also lead to interpersonal challenges if not kept in balance.
